Vietnam calls for EU’s stronger actions to jointly address global challenges

(VOVWORLD) -Ambassador Dang Hoang Giang, Vietnam’s Permanent Representative to the United Nations, spoke highly of the EU’s role and expressed his hope that the EU will make greater contributions to the multilateral system and the UN to address current global challenges amid increasingly complicated international situation and competition.

Ambassador Giang made the statement during a talk in New York on Friday with the group of Ambassadors of the EU Political and Security Committee and the ambassadors of several UN members on the world situation and inter-regional cooperation in international peace and security issues.

Ambassador Giang proposed strengthening Vietnam-EU cooperation in the areas of mutual interest including maritime security, water security, upholding international law, and respect for the basic principles of the UN Charter.

He insisted that the EU and its member countries are Vietnam’s most important partners, calling for EU’s specific and practical measures to support Vietnam's socio-economic development, implement the Sustainable Development Goals, and respond to non-traditional security challenges.

The proposed measures include the early ratification of the EU-Vietnam Investment Protection Agreement, implementation of the Just Energy Transition Partnership (JETP) initiative, and removal of the IUU yellow card for Vietnam's seafood products.
